Transaction 76632cfc627620d60c727867b6b859e388dff5da6adcc6a719e51458967fade9
1 Input
1 Output
-
76632cfc627620d60c727867b6b859e388dff5da6adcc6a719e51458967fade9:0
- value
- 53783300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91247904bb1c0582d40a0867f1519279a7f88895 OP_EQUAL
- address
- 3EvTbXd1kzvkPsrABbYNphYGWZA5Sxq8Jb